Cost of Replacement Glass

If you've broken a window pane, your glazier will replace it with a new double glazed glass unit. This will cost between $75 and $210, depending on the repair work required. A blown window is caused when a gap is created between the window panels, which allows moisture to seep into the frame and cause fogging or misting. This can be caused by damage to the window seals or the deterioration of the seals over time. It is recommended to repair blown windows as soon as you can to prevent further damage and costly repairs.

Cost of replacing seals

Moisture between the window panes is one of the most frequent issues homeowners confront with double glazing. This is typically an indication that the thermal seal has broken, and it can reduce the energy efficiency of windows. Window experts can repair or replace the thermal sealing to correct this issue. They can also seal the windows to improve insulation and lower electric bills.

The cost to repair or replace one glass pane in double-glazed windows could vary from $50 to 200 depending on the size and complexity.
